Where Is Area Code 810?

Area code 810 is located in Michigan, United States. It primarily serves east-central and southeastern portions of the state. Major communities associated with the area code include Flint, Lapeer, and Port Huron, along with many surrounding communities.

The 810 numbering area also extends into portions of the southern Thumb region and nearby counties.

What Cities Use Area Code 810?

The 810 area code covers numerous Michigan communities. Some of the better-known cities and communities include:

  • Flint
  • Port Huron
  • Lapeer
  • Burton
  • Fenton
  • Flushing
  • Grand Blanc
  • Brighton
  • Marysville
  • Davison
  • Swartz Creek
  • St. Clair
  • Marine City
  • Algonac
  • Imlay City
  • Sandusky
  • Clio
  • Linden
  • Brown City
  • Yale
  • Capac
  • Croswell

The exact service area includes many additional smaller communities.

What Time Zone Is Area Code 810 In?

The 810 area code is in the Eastern Time Zone.

This means locations using 810 generally observe:

  • Eastern Standard Time (EST) during standard time
  • Eastern Daylight Time (EDT) during daylight saving time

When calling an 810 number from another time zone, remember to consider the local time in Michigan.

When Was Area Code 810 Created?

Area code 810 was introduced on December 1, 1993.

It was created from a portion of Michigan’s 313 numbering area as demand for telephone numbers increased.

The original 810 territory was larger than it is today. Parts of the area were later separated to create additional area codes, including 248 and 586.

Is 810 a Scam Area Code?

The 810 area code itself is not a scam. It is a legitimate Michigan area code.

However, scammers can use phone numbers from legitimate area codes. Caller ID can also be manipulated through spoofing, making a call appear to come from a local number.

Be cautious if an unfamiliar 810 number:

  • Demands immediate payment
  • Requests passwords or verification codes
  • Claims you’ve won a prize
  • Threatens legal action
  • Requests sensitive personal information
  • Asks you to install unfamiliar software
  • Pressures you to send money

If you don’t recognize the caller, consider letting the call go to voicemail and independently verifying any claims.

Nearby Michigan Area Codes

Michigan has several other area codes surrounding or near the 810 region.

Some include:

  • 248/947 — Oakland County and surrounding communities
  • 313 — Detroit and nearby communities
  • 517 — South-central Michigan
  • 586 — Northeastern Metro Detroit
  • 734 — Ann Arbor and southeastern Michigan
  • 989 — Northern and northeastern Lower Michigan

The boundaries between area codes have changed over time as Michigan’s telephone numbering needs have grown.

Does 810 Have an Overlay?

Current numbering information lists 810 as a standalone area code rather than an overlay complex. NANPA’s reporting identifies 810 separately, while some other Michigan area codes, such as 248 and 947, operate as an overlay.
